Once this connection is built, then swse sent all further request to aom directly. Remember this is done automatically when apply the logical profile on web server but for learning purpose we are going to do it manually. You can use this topic to learn about software load balancing for software defined networking in windows server 2016. Web servers can be load balanced using hardware or software load balancers available in the market. Server load balancing substitutes for siebel native load balancing. After you install and configure the siebel servers and install the siebel web server extension swse, you start the swse configuration wizard to enable siebel native load balancing. Oracle siebel crm architect the federal reserve system careers. Software load balancing slb for sdn microsoft docs. I have 5 dedicated servers with windows 2003 server os where i need to install siebel 8. Load balancing is a method for distributing tasks onto multiple computers. Siebel fully supports all 64 bit operating systems. Load balancing is maintained by the gateway server using the third party software resonate central dispatch. Siebel connection broker load balancing algorithm oracle.
Can anyone help me how to enter sieble host server parameter in this situation. Manage the siebel servers from the siebel web client. Working with cloud architects to automate and template the siebel builds. The siebel connection broker, scbroker, tries to balance the load incoming requests across different object manager processes running in a single siebel server. Once a particular client is connected to an app server, it will use only that app server for the rest of the session, no matter what, the load on that app server is. Install and configure siebel charts and oracle bi publisher for siebel. Siebel interview questions what is the use of catch in escript. If one siebel server fails, then requests are automatically routed to the remaining siebel servers. Page 3 resilience and ability to keep recovering from multiple failures onpremises failures have to be handled on a casebycase basis. Siebel is atypical of many ntiered application architectures.
I have four siebel application servers running in load balancing and connected to single repository. Key components such as the siebel gateway name server have to be clustered using expensive clustering. Explain how is load balancing maintained in siebel. I do not have native load balancing so no virtual host. Now lets modify our g file to enable the load balance on the web server. Resonate is kind of a black box to most of us in the siebel community. The appdirector appliance can be placed in front of the web servers and can load balance requests. If you are using siebel load balancing, then swse forwards the request to a siebel server in roundrobin fashion. If you continue browsing the site, you agree to the use of cookies on this website. This paper describes the siebel maximum availability architecture maa, a best practice blueprint for achieving an optimal siebel high availability deployment using oracle high availability technologies and recommendations. The siebel web architecture in order to allow thousands of users access to critical enterprise data over the web channel, siebel crm is based on a typical web architecture. Identification of software to be transitioned transition plan creation of transition scope and execution plan and, if needed, tailored scripts.
The siebel application requires layer 7 load balancing for the aom. As server technology and power has increased dramatically over the past few years while prices have been pegged back the possibility of deploying ever more powerful virtual load balancers have become ever more feasible and attractive compared with hardware appliances. Installing and managing a complex enterprise application such as oracles siebel crm can be challenging. Best practices for running oracle siebel crm on aws.
Will there be any change in the load balancing of requests by the sr. Configuring siebel server software on microsoft windows. However, the load balancing is only for the initial connection. One for the gateway, one for the enterprise, one for the. Resonate is thirdparty software development tool, which is used for distributing the client request to the least laden siebel server.
Founded on a serviceoriented architecture, the software includes a large number of. Implementing f5 load balancing external and opening up the application to internet in dmz via reverse proxy configuration. Siebel tools configuration interview questions,answers aired. Siebel web architecture upgrading from siebel 2000 to 7 sl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. This module provides softwarebased load balancing for siebel servers. As far as my knowledge goes, siebel uses resonate for load balancing. Siebel itself can use native load balancing version 7.
Siebel wtc tuxedo we made a poc on this which is working fine. This website uses cookies to ensure you get the best experience on our website. Five reasons to use a software load balancer nginx. Siebel provides the core components, while relies on third parties for web server, database, and so forth.
Each siebel server runs an instance of the service that you want to load balance. Resonate and siebel load balancing recursive technology. Webservers since you already have multiple webservers, it shouldn. This process is described in detail later in this section. A load balancer works as a middleman between the client and the servers by accepting requests from clients and distributing the requests to the backend servers based on the configured parameters. You dont have to generate the file twice, just generate it once and update it as per your requirements and copy it to all web servers. In my designer client under import from siebel wizard i need to provide siebel host server. Jan 04, 2016 an approach which is very different from both roundrobin dns and clientside random balancing, is to use serverside load balancers.
Oracles siebel platform sizing and performance program pspp is designed to stress the siebel crm release 8. Cisco lean retail oracle siebel 8 application deployment guide. Each application must be defined as its own server farm. Siebel architecture overview outlined here is an attempt to simplify concepts and provide a depiction of the components that power siebel crm applications. Though some server processes still use 32 bit binaries, many of the processes used for integration and security and rendering of user interfaces use 64 bit.
Cloud service providers csps and enterprises that are deploying software defined networking sdn in windows server 2016 can use software load balancing slb to evenly distribute tenant and tenant customer network traffic. Several siebel features are exercised, including webbased interactions, the network architecture, load balancing. Load balancer is usually an additional box, sitting in front of your servers, and doing, as advertised, load balancing. Siebel server load balancing for application servers is typically done after the siebel servers and database server have been installed, but can be done before the web servers are installed. The most elegant and easiest to use load balancer available. The servers in this case dont require any configuration changes and it can be deployed easily without any delay. Principal software engineer siebel server architecture supports spawning multiple application object manager processes. Configuration of native load balancing and scbroker in siebel 8. Expertise in architectural and technical aspects of siebel crm installations, architecture design, performance tuning, high availability, load balancingfailover, troubleshooting demonstrated organizational, communication written and verbal, and interpersonal skills including the ability to effectively interact with individuals at all. Deployment guide deploying oracle siebel with netscaler 8 deploying oracle siebel with netscaler deployment guide after clicking ok, you will see the basic settings screen for the lb vserver.
Nov 08, 2008 siebel web architecture upgrading from siebel 2000 to 7. May 04, 2004 highlights from siebel user week in cannes, france. When you install swse, the installation wizard prompts you for information about configuring load balancing. Microsoft network load balancing service acts as a softwarebased load balancer to the web server tier.
In this case, each web server is directly tied to an application. Deploying oracle siebel crm on oracles sun storage 7000. I will explain some common load balancing schemes in. Hi experts we have two siebel servers load balancing fins and ecommunications oms. Load balancing distributes workload across multiple siebel server computers. To use the native round robin load balancing provided by the siebel session manager, there are 3 changes that must be made. This feature provides information about contentbased routing, which provides a load balancing configuration for your configurable products.
The architecture described here holds good for siebel v8. Open cmd and change the path to %siebel server installation directory%binb. When two or more siebel servers host the same component and should take the load of the user sessions evenly, then we should configure the swse for siebel native load balancing. With siebel native load balancing, a load balancing module is built into the siebel web server extension swse. How will you edit the joined fields values in join. Load balancing the siebel application enables you to generate a load balancing script for rest services. How is tools architecture constructed in in siebel. How to do load balancing on siebel server manually siebel. File server if its in san, ideally san should be able to resotore it elsewhere. These material are compiled for helping junior senior software engineers and others.
Fully featured, waf, gslb, traffic management, preauthentication and sso dont take our word for it download a free trial or take a test drive online. Frequently asked siebel crm interview questions and. You may be able to extend it further to cover your environment scenarios. When we take one server down the access to the application is still available, we can login into both applications, when we go to administration server management enterprise we saw that one server is down, after taking the server up again we cannot view the server green again, we need to relogon to see the. But resonate siebel is still used in thousands of siebel sites and needs a further look. Systems hardware and software and f5 load balancers hardware f5 bigip local traffic manager v9 3400 series. Configuration of native load balancing and scbroker in siebel. To enable round robin load balancing, the variables listed in the following table must be set. Oct 06, 2011 siebel server architecture supports spawning multiple application object manager processes. Configuring siebel load balancing in siebel crm tutorial. Siebel administratorplatform architect with over 8 years 6 months of experience in information technology industry specialized in siebel crm implementations across solarislinuxwindows platforms.
Actually this is normal web server like microsoft iis or apache server but a siebel plugin called, siebel web server extension swse is installed for siebel. This module provides software based load balancing for siebel servers. There are a few different ways to implement load balancing. Load balancing, distributed services and clustering no downtime no downtime minutes siebel upgrades.
The load balancer uses customerconfigured routing rules to forward the request to a siebel server. I still want to seek expert opinion on this to understand if this approach would face any issue wrt performance, load balancing, missing transactions or availability. As with any enterprise software this can be as complex as they come. Siebel web server the siebel web server is used to serve pages to the siebel clients.
Integration architecture for partners initiative, partners validated integrations are able. Load balancing considerations on windows platforms. Siebel servers have multiple servers, they can coexist in the same environment, if one fails, enable the failed serverss components in the other. Founded on a serviceoriented architecture, the software includes a large number of architectural modules. When we take one server down the access to the application is still available, we can login into both applications, when we go to administration server management enterprise we saw that one. When you install swse, the installation wizard prompts you for information about. Two methods are available for implementing siebel server load balancing for aoms. Identification of onpremises architecture database server, siebel web server, web server, siebel server, single signon, load balancing, etc. Siebel runtime repository version rollback the siebel runtime repository version rollback feature allows you to revert to the last known good version of a deployed application metadata siebel repository. Siebel native load balancing is a software based round robin strategy to evenly. The siebel load balancing instance resides in the siebel web server extension swse on the web servers. It allows more efficient use of network bandwidth and reduces provisioning costs. You are really load balancing the requests coming into your web servers, so it is a generic architecture thing unrelated to the application you are implementing load balancing on.
About the siebel software configuration wizard in siebel. Here, you may change settings such as the session persistence method, authentication and load balancing methods. We can manage multiple siebel applications using load balancing strategies. What difference between fields and single value fields. Bigip load balancing, optimization, ssl, and application. Configuration of native load balancing and scbroker in. You generate the load balancing configuration file lbconfig. Amazon vpc 9 aws direct connect 9 siebel crm architecture on aws and deployment best practices 9 traffic distribution and load balancing 10 scalability 11 architecting for high availability and disaster recovery 12. Introducing the siebel web architecture oracle siebel.
Siebel application is made up of both siebel and third party components. This architecture allows for great scalability and platform compatibility and has been under development for more than a decade. Per app load balancing provides a high degree of application isolation, avoids overprovisioning of load balancers, and eliminates the constraints of supporting numerous applications on one load balancer. Load balancing is maintained by the gateway server using the thirdparty software resonate central dispatch. Siebel has generally relied on resonate load balancing software. Jul 07, 2016 were proud to announce the release of our latest ebook, five reasons to switch to software for load balancing, by floyd smith. Siebel servers, and helps to format it into web pages for siebel clients. The load balancing architecture also can be different from installation to installation.
Appendix dnetwork management describes the network mana gement software used in the lean retail oracle siebel 8 solution. Siebel does not and cannot provide web load balancing as this is outside the domain of the application. The client end user pc must be connected to a local area network to access siebel information. Siebel platform architect project lead resume milwaukee. Coordinating and supporting the e2e testing to fix platform migration defects. Demonstrated organizational, communication written and verbal, and interpersonal skills including the ability to effectively interact with individuals at all. A critical success factor in every platform modernization. Implement load balancing and support multilanguage environments. Feb, 2012 how to do load balancing on siebel server manually steps. The web client is easy to maintain because it does not require any special siebel specific software or addins. Load balancing is maitained by the gateway server using the third party software resonate central dispatch. Highlights from siebel user week in cannes, france zdnet. The following screenshot shows the siebel software configuration wizard in console mode.
Siebel open ui is a more mature, modern way to take that experience into the future. Netscaler is used in siebel to provide the requests to be transferred from client browser to the server using the load balancing features that are provided by the siebel servers. If present, web server load balancing software evaluates the request and determines the best web server to forward the request to. Load balancing is widely used in datacenter networks to distribute traffic across many existing paths between any two servers.
Aug 15, 2012 siebel web server the siebel web server is used to serve pages to the siebel clients. For a siebel application developer, this is transparent. Deploying oracle siebel crm on sun storage 7000 unified. Learn more about its pricing details and check what experts think about its features and integrations. Had worked with multiple full cycle siebel implementations siebel 8.
Dec 04, 2010 siebel connection brokerscbroker scboker provides intraserver load balancing. We use your linkedin profile and activity data to personalize ads and to show you more relevant ads. Install and configure siebel crm software on microsoft windows and linux. Elastic load balancing 7 amazon ebs 8 amazon machine images 8. In general, load balancing in datacenter networks can be classified as either static or dynamic. Siebel connection brokerscbroker, siebel request broker. Jul 31, 2014 nginx plus builds on the functionality of the open source nginx software the engine that powers more than 66% of the worlds most popular websites to create a powerful load balancing and traffic management platform, in software, that provides all you need to successfully and reliably deliver your applications. Expertise in architectural and technical aspects of siebel crm installations, architecture design, performance tuning, high availability, load balancingfailover, troubleshooting.
However,the more common scenario is to use the utility in gui mode and enter the parameters from the planning document in the dialogs displayed by the software configuration wizard. Load balancing siebel web servers does not require any specific configuration changes on the web server. Two options for siebel server load balancing are siebel load balancing. Virtual business component is used to display the data from another legacy database table, in the siebel screen.
1253 1401 62 493 1451 1499 300 547 358 401 896 1441 810 749 840 281 150 405 1506 156 708 925 346 1461 1044 1331 251 880 257 392 300 961 265 907 215 251 1259 1168 1249 204 1465 355